tremulous
英 [ˈtremjələs]
美 [ˈtremjələs]
adj. (因紧张)颤抖的,战栗的; 使打战的; 使颤动的
BNC.26269 / COCA.24494
牛津词典
adj.
- (因紧张)颤抖的,战栗的;使打战的;使颤动的
shaking slightly because you are nervous; causing you to shake slightly- a tremulous voice
颤抖的声音 - He was in a state of tremulous excitement.
他激动得直发抖。
- a tremulous voice
柯林斯词典
- ADJ-GRADED (声音或动作)震颤的,颤抖的,打战的;(笑容)怯生生的,不自然的
If someone's voice, smile, or actions aretremulous, they are unsteady because the person is uncertain, afraid, or upset.- She fidgeted in her chair as she took a deep, tremulous breath.
她在椅子上坐立不安,轻颤着深吸了一口气。
- She fidgeted in her chair as she took a deep, tremulous breath.
